| Obverse description | Right-facing bust of Queen Elizabeth II wearing St. Edward's Crown in high relief, with the façade of Westminster Abbey rendered in lower relief behind. The circumferential legend arcs around the upper field, and the coronation date inscription appears in three lines across the lower exergue. The engraver's signature P. VINCZE is visible at the bottom of the field. |
